Savant Capital LLC Acquires New Stake in CNX Resources Co. (NYSE:CNX)

Savant Capital LLC bought a new position in CNX Resources Co. (NYSE:CNXFree Report) during the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m bought 7,120 shares of the oil and gas producer’s stock, valued at approximately $261,000.

CNX Resources Profile

(Free Report)

CNX Resources Corporation, an independent natural gas and midstream company, engages in the acquisition, exploration, development, and production of natural gas properties in the Appalachian Basin. The company operates in two segments, Shale and Coalbed Methane (CBM). It produces and sells pipeline quality natural gas primarily for gas wholesalers.
